Labour Minister Prepares Nearly 20,000 Beds in Hospitels For Insured Persons to Support COVID-19 Patients

          Labour Minister Mr. Suchart Chomklin spoke about the progress on bed management to support Sections 33 and 39 insured persons infected with COVID-19 from the current pandemic situation. He said that the Ministry of Labour by the Social Security Office had prepared hospital medical personnel in the social security network, with nearly 20,000 beds in Hospitels; approximately 12,000 beds have been used. Once the insured person recovers and the doctors allow them to go home, the beds will be empty again. Insured persons are circulating in and out every day. At the same time, the Social Security Office will coordinate to find additional beds to support adequate treatment of the insured. MOL Joins Sustainable Development Committee Meeting No. 1/2022

          On January 17, 2022, Permanent Secretary of Labour Mr. Boonchob Suttamanaswong joined the Sustainable Development (SD) Board of Director’s Meeting No. 1/2022 via the electronic system at the Permanent Secretary of Labour’s Meeting Room, 7th Floor, Ministry of Labour. The meeting monitored the progress of the mission-driven action of the responsible agencies and coordinated the principles of driving the 17 Sustainable Development Goals and 169 targets. It also acknowledged the implementation of Thailand’s SDG Roadmap, the Voluntary National Review (VNR) 2021, considered improvements to sub-committees and working groups under the Sustainable Development Committee, including guidelines for driving the country’s sustainable development goals in the next phase. Deputy Prime Minister General Prawit Wongsuwan chaired the meeting. —————————— Division of Public Relations 17 January 2022

Labour Minister Joins as Witness in Sending-Receiving Some Part of the “Benjakitti” Forest Part Phases 2 & 3 to Add More Green Areas in Bangkok City

          Today (December 17, 2021) at 09.00 hours, Prime Minister and Minister of Defence General Prayuth Chan-ocha and Labour Minister Mr. Suchart Chomklin joined as witnesses the signing of the memorandum of handing over some parts of the “Benjakitti” forest park phase 2 and 3, between the Royal Thai Army and the Treasury Department, and the Treasury Department and the Bangkok Metropolitan Administration. The Royal Thai Army has completed the construction of construction site one, which has an area of approximately 160 rai, one ngan, 76 square wa. The representatives of all three units consisted of 1) the Royal Thai Army, General Siripoj Rampaikul, Chairman of the Advisory Board of the Royal Thai Army, 2) the Treasury Department, Mr. Praphas Kong-iad, Director-General of the Treasury Department, and 3) Bangkok Metropolitan Administration, Khachit Chatchavanich, Permanent Secretary of the BMA. The three parties signed the memorandum of handing over and receiving some parts of the “Benjakitti” forest park phase 2 and 3. The Prime Minister handed over a letter of authorization to use the royal property to the Bangkok Metropolitan Administration. ++++++++++++++++++++ Division of Public Relations 17 December 2021

Labour Minister Assigns Permanent Secretary to Join Ceremony to Award Rights to Low-Income Group Rental Housing Project

          On December 3, 2021, Labour Minister Mr. Suchart Chomklin assigned Permanent Secretary of Labour Mr. Boonchob Suttamanaswong to join in the honour of awarding the rights to the rental housing project for low-income groups for the Suk Pracha Romklao Housing Project. The Prime Minister General Prayuth Chan-ocha presided over the awarding ceremony at the Romklao Community Housing Project, Romklao Road, Khlong Song Ton Noon Subdistrict, Lat Krabang District, Bangkok.           The Suk Pracha Romklao Housing Project is a housing project for low-income groups under the Ministry of Social Development and Human Security. The project is by the National Housing Authority, which received an urgent policy from the government to develop housing to meet the goals of the 20-year Housing Development Master Plan (2017-2036) to create housing security for the low-income groups affected by the COVID-19 situation. Therefore, a housing project for low-income groups was developed, starting with the pilot project “Baan Kheha Sukpracha” (Chalong Krung and Rom Klao) to provide assistance and provide housing security for low-income people.
